Discover more about Riyam Censer

The Riyam Censer in Muscat stands as a striking testament to the architectural beauty and cultural depth of Oman. This iconic monument, designed in the shape of a giant incense burner, is not only an artistic marvel but also a symbol of the country's long-standing traditions in incense production. Visitors are greeted by panoramic views of the surrounding landscape, making it an ideal spot for photography enthusiasts and nature lovers alike. The location is particularly enchanting during sunset, when the warm hues of the sky blend with the soft glow of the monument, creating a picturesque backdrop. As you approach the Riyam Censer, you'll notice its intricate design and elaborate details, which reflect the craftsmanship of Omani artisans. The monument is set in a well-maintained park that offers ample space for relaxation and a leisurely stroll. You'll find well-marked paths that guide you through lush greenery, inviting you to explore the area further. The site is also equipped with benches and viewpoints, making it a perfect gathering spot for families, couples, and solo travelers. The best time to visit is during the cooler months, from October to March, when the weather is most pleasant for outdoor activities.     Getting There

    Car

    If you are driving, start from central Muscat. Navigate to Al Fahal Street (Road 1), which leads towards Qurum. Continue on this road until you reach the roundabout near Qurum beach. Take the second exit to stay on Road 1. Follow the signs for Riyam Censer; after about 10 minutes of driving, you'll see the sign for the Riyam Monument on your right. There is parking available near the monument.

    Public Transportation

    If you are using public transportation, take a bus from the central bus station in Muscat. Look for buses heading towards Qurum. You'll want to get off at the stop closest to the Qurum area. From there, you can take a taxi or a local ride-hailing service to reach the Riyam Censer. The taxi ride will take about 10 minutes and should cost around 2 to 3 Omani Rials.

    Walking

    If you are already in the Qurum area, you can walk to the Riyam Censer. From the Qurum beach area, head towards Al Maha Street, and then follow the directional signs. The walk will take approximately 20 minutes, providing you with a scenic route through the local area.
